Global supply chain definition

The definition of global supply chain management is quite simple and straightforward. The value chain is a network around the world that businesses use to manufacture and supply goods or services. This network spans across different countries and continents. However, managing a global chain involves a complete process, including manufacturing, employees, resources, raw material, and professionals.

What is the difference between the global supply chain and the local supply chain?

A global supply chain is a network that helps organizations to use low-cost countries attached to the global supply chain. These countries manufacture goods with low labor rates and low production cost in that country. A global supply chain system can be operational from your home as a buyer with a team of supplier tiers. These supplier tiers are from different countries and locations.

Local supply chains involve suppliers from your organization’s region. The products from the local supply chain distribute within a specific region or country only.

What is supply chain management, and why is it important?

Supply chain management is a process of monitoring the production of goods from raw material to fine finished goods. Supply management is useful in reducing the cost of products and get a considerable profit. It also includes logistics services for smooth manufacturing of goods. For this purpose, a company hires a supply chain manager to monitor the process. The supply chain manager will observe the following procedures.

Procurement of raw material

In this process, supply chain managers find raw materials for products and sign a contract with the supplier. The agreement also includes the shipping of raw material to manufacturing sites or warehouses for further process.

Finding manufacturing sites and warehouses

Finding a manufacturing site is a crucial step in supply chain management. Many factors need to be considered when finding a manufacturing site. These factors include the site’s size, the volume of goods, distance from the supplier, and logistics of moving goods to the next stage.

Ensure partnership agreements

Supply chain managers must ensure all the partnership agreements. According to the agreements, the suppliers and manufacturers will ensure the timely production of goods and their quality.

Transportation

This step needs proper planning and strategy because this can minimize or maximize the costs.  Effective supply chain management strategies operating expenses to get profit.

Tackle the changes to scheduled events

Running a huge business involves time management. To achieve the goals, supply chain managers must plan a schedule for smooth working. Any delay in delivering material from morning to evening may have a massive impact on the rest of the chain process.

Inventory Management

Inventory is a list of products. This process includes collecting materials, storing, fetching, and dispatching products to different sites. Any delay in the process may affect the whole supply chain process. A chain manager must be meticulous in managing inventory as it brings a huge profit to the company.

Customers’ product demands

The customer is the beginner of a supply chain because supply network management depends on their orders. Therefore, it is necessary to meet all the requirements of customers to provide the best products. Customer satisfaction is the base of supply chain management.

Shipping Process

This process includes packaging the products and then shipping to the customers. The chain manager ensures the safe packaging and shipping of the product not to be damaged. Then a customer gives good feedback by praising the company and products. This gains the customers’ trust, and they order more products. However, shipping time is also an important factor to consider.

Shipping optimization

According to Logistic Management’s “The State of Logistic report (u.s news world report)” freight transportation costs increased dramatically from 2016 to 2017. The full truckload cost increased by 6.4%, Less-than-truckload cost increased by 6.6%, private or dedicated 9.5%, and air freight 3.1%. Due to an increase in transportation cost, shipping optimization became necessary in supply chains. Supply chains identify the most suitable shipping method for every parcel like small parcels, large bulk orders, and other shipping methods to find the lowest price. It improves the company’s bottom line and customer satisfaction.

Why is the global supply chain so difficult?

Managing a global supply chain is challenging in current times because every industry is thriving hard to reach worldwide customers. Companies try their best to reduce production costs, increase profit, and improve productivity in the global marketplace. A successful business must need a powerful global value-added chain management to stand in the global market.

Here are some challenges that a business may face in global supply chain management.

Conflict in business objective and requirements

A primary challenge that every business and company may face is conflict in business objectives and requirements. For example, a supplier will prefer a manufacturing company who buys a large amount of raw material regularly. The supplier will demand the best possible price for raw products. ‘ On the other hand, the manufacturing company wants to purchase raw material at the lowest price. Also, the manufacturer will want flexibility in purchasing raw materials like when and how to purchase.

Currency Alteration

The other challenge is to find the best currency exchange sources to get the best rates. A company has to deal with international suppliers and customers to buy and sell products. The company must plan for currency exchange charges and income.

Reliability of international business partners

Global logistics network management involves international distributors, suppliers, customers, and business partners. It is difficult to find reliable business partners to grow the business. It is difficult to monitor the business practices of different organizations in the global logistics chain.

Financial Transaction and Insurance

Managing the finances in the local logistics network is easy as compared to the global supply chain. International transactions are more complicated than the local transaction. A company has to establish a bank account with complete details of business and earnings. He also has to pay taxes and get insurance to secure the transactions.

Acceptance of International standards and regulations

The quality standards, packaging import, and export product regulations, and labeling regulations are different in different regions of the world. A company must ensure and meet all the rules and regulations regarding import and export for the successful global supply chain management. Business programs have to pay a fine sometimes if they do not meet the international regulations.
